Genuine Communication Skills
A great bartender is a master of conversation, effortlessly connecting with patrons and colleagues alike. They listen attentively, understanding each guest's desires, and deftly share drink options with clarity and charisma.
Customer-First Mentality
At the heart of every great bartender beats a passion for service. They greet guests with warmth, intuitively anticipating needs, and respecting personal space cues with finesse.

Meticulous Attention to Detail
From remembering names to customizing drinks, a stellar bartender is meticulous in their craft. They maintain a meticulously organized bar, ensuring every ingredient is in its place for seamless service.
Boundless Creativity
Mixing drinks is an art, and a great bartender is a true artist. They infuse creativity into every concoction, crafting signature drinks that captivate the senses and elevate the drinking experience.
Masterful Multitasking
In the hustle and bustle of a busy bar, multitasking is key. A stellar bartender juggles orders, pours drinks, and engages with patrons – all with a smile and a steady hand.
Adaptive Flexibility
The bar scene is ever-changing, and a great bartender adapts with ease. They remain calm under pressure, navigating unexpected challenges with grace and composure.
Deep Knowledge
Behind the bar, knowledge is power. A stellar bartender is a fountain of information, well-versed in spirits, cocktails, and industry trends, ready to educate and inspire.

Infinite Patience
In the face of adversity, patience prevails. A great bartender handles even the most challenging patrons with patience and poise, defusing tension with empathy and understanding.
Sense of Humor
Laughter is the best mixer, and a great bartender serves it up with every drink. They sprinkle humor into conversations, fostering a jovial atmosphere that keeps patrons coming back for more.
Unwavering Responsibility
With great libations comes great responsibility. A stellar bartender monitors alcohol intake, intervenes when necessary, and ensures the safety and well-being of all patrons.
